Output f56e6ae3007971d53b340f4610172f55df69458ad0c91b6b0874901866693d30:1

value
17991838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e27d298c4b7accf7cc10187127e4ade38860ba6d OP_EQUAL
address
3NLaaKss5RgFha2eNB4yc1xTV3P848JG7W
transaction
f56e6ae3007971d53b340f4610172f55df69458ad0c91b6b0874901866693d30
spent
true